Your guide to Annapolis

All About Annapolis

The capital of Maryland, Annapolis sits on the banks of Chesapeake Bay and is known for its historic neighborhoods and 18th-century Colonial, Georgian, and Victorian homes. With its reputation as the sailing capital of the United States, and home to the U.S. Naval Academy, Annapolis holds several significant historical credentials, including a founding that dates back to 1649. St. John's College, one of the oldest universities in the country, still stands proud on Annapolis soil.

Today, this prosperous East Coast city is known more for its thriving downtown Historic District with boutique shops, galleries, and architectural sites that provide a day of exploration before heading to the Eastport District, where the Annapolis culinary scene emphasizes locally sourced oysters, crabs, and scallops. For nightlife, West Street is where you will find several bars, clubs, and restaurants, many of which regularly host live music on the weekends.


The best time to stay in a vacation rental in Annapolis

Annapolis experiences drastic weather changes from season to season. The summer months tend to be hot and humid, with moderate precipitation and long pleasant nights. Several festivals occur during the summer days, like a Renaissance fair in a fictional 16th-century village with costumed events, vendors, and medieval-era arts and crafts. Or the weekly Wednesday Night Sailboat Races that take place from May through September.

The winter sees temperatures drop to below freezing with an occasional dusting of snow. However, Annapolis’ warm cafes and cozy street-side restaurants can make brisk days feel quite pleasant. The shoulder seasons are an excellent time to look for vacation rentals in Annapolis, as the spring weather conditions that are temperate also mark the beginning of the sailing season. The fall hosts a brilliant display of autumn hues in the treetops throughout the city with similar weather patterns to that of spring.


Top things to do in Annapolis

Annapolis Maritime Museum

This waterfront museum houses several exhibitions and displays that detail the area's maritime history and the ocean's significance in its economic, social, and cultural developments. Exhibits explain Chesapeake Bay’s unique ecological makeup and how it has impacted the fishing industry over the years. In addition, several art and photography displays highlight the region's social makeup through contributions by local and internationally renowned artists.

Historic London Town

Located just outside of Annapolis in the town of Edgewater, this 23-acre park is a recreation of a lost 18th-century colonial village that would have been common in the area at the time. A carpenter's shop, mayor's tenement, picnic areas, and ten acres of woodland and ornamental gardens are all waiting to be explored in the area. Recreated through a series of archeological discoveries, most of the buildings are full of everyday objects that would have been found and used at the time.

Lake Waterford Park

This 108-acre park is where the locals come to stretch out when the weather is nice. It includes a full lineup of recreational activities, from tennis courts to football fields. Walking trails and hiking paths meander through much of the wooded park, and there’s a 12-acre lake for spotting waterfowl and fishing from the shores.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• How is the weather in Annapolis?

    Annapolis has a temperate climate. Summers are hot and humid with temperatures around 85°F (29°C), while winters are chilly, around 40°F (4°C). Spring and autumn are mild, making these seasons popular for visiting.

  • What are some of the best things to do in Annapolis?

    Visitors to Annapolis can tour the United States Naval Academy, sail on the Chesapeake Bay, or explore the historic district. The Arts District is also popular for its galleries and studios.

  • What is the best time of year to visit Annapolis?

    Spring and fall are often suggested for a visit to Annapolis due to the mild and enjoyable weather. Spring brings the annual Annapolis Film Festival, and the U.S. Sailboat Show takes place in October, attracting a large number of visitors.

  • What are the best places to stay in Annapolis?

    Downtown Annapolis is frequently suggested as it's close to historic sites, restaurants, and shopping. Eastport, with its maritime charm, and West Annapolis, known for its quaint, village-like atmosphere, are also popular options.

  • What are the best places to visit in Annapolis?

    The Maryland State House, St. Anne's Episcopal Church, and the William Paca House are popular places to visit. The Annapolis Historic District and the Annapolis Maritime Museum are also frequently suggested.

  • What are some hiking trails in Annapolis?

    Annapolis has several scenic trails such as the 3.3-mile (5.3 km) Baltimore and Annapolis Trail and the shorter but equally beautiful 1.7-mile (2.7 km) Quiet Waters Park Trail. Both are suitable for varying skill levels.

  • What are some family activities to do in Annapolis?

    Families can explore the Maryland State House, navigate the stars at the Maryland Planetarium, or enjoy a day of fun at the Annapolis Maritime Museum. Children will also enjoy the interactive exhibits at the Chesapeake Children's Museum.

  • What are some of the best day trip ideas in Annapolis?

    A day trip by boat to St. Michael's, a charming historic town, is a great idea. You can also visit Sandy Point State Park for a beach day or journey to Baltimore, which is just 32 miles (51.5 km) away, for more city experiences.
